Inflation, oscillation and quantum creation of the universe in gauge extended supergravities

Description

In gauge extended supergravities, the combined effect of the large cosmological constant allowed and the one-loop topological Casimir effect can give rise to both inflation and an oscillating universe. This is considered in detail for gauged N=4 supergravity. The probability is estimated for the quantum creation of universes; finally, the possibility is pointed out of extending these results to gauged N=8 supergravity. (orig.)
